Who This Griddle Fits: Compatible Weber Models and Use Cases

Because fit matters for performance, check your grill model before buying: the Stanbroil flat top is designed specifically for Weber Genesis II and Genesis II LX 300-series gas grills (2017 and newer), including Genesis II 310, 315, 335, 345, Genesis II LX 340, and Genesis 325/335 (2022). If you own one of those compatible models, installation is straightforward and you’ll gain a 430 sq. inch cook surface ideal for breakfast, camping, tailgating, and backyard parties. If you have older Genesis 300-series grills (2007–2016), it won’t fit. Consider your typical use cases—teppanyaki, pancakes, steaks—to decide if this griddle matches your cooking needs. Installation, Cleaning, and Practical Tips for Long-Term Use

If you want hassle-free setup and long service life from the Stanbroil griddle, installation is straightforward: remove the grill grates and flavorizer bars, slide the stainless-steel plate into place, and secure it—no special tools required—and you’ll be ready to cook in minutes. For cleaning, scrape while warm, wipe with a damp cloth, and use mild detergent for stubborn spots; avoid abrasive pads to preserve finish. For long-term care, follow simple maintenance hacks like oiling lightly after drying and checking fit periodically. Store flat in a dry place; compact storage solutions prevent warping and extend durability.
